Phyllis Jones Tackett, 75, of McDowell, wife of Cleveland Tackett, died Tuesday, June 12, 2012, at her residence.

Born Nov. 22, 1936, at Ligon, to the late Silas and Fannie Elswick Jones, she was a homemaker and a member of McDowell First Baptist Church.

In addition to her husband, she is survived by a son, Larry Steve Spears, of McDowell; a daughter, Melinda Hockenberry, of Marietta, Ohio; a stepson, Michael Tackett, of Prestonsburg; seven grandchildren; three great grandchildren; and a host of nieces and nephews.

In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her brothers and sisters-in-law, Silas and Dorinda Jones and Leroy and Greta Jones.

Funeral services for Phyllis Jones Tackett will be held at 11 a.m., Saturday, June 16, at Nelson Frazier Funeral Home, in Martin, with Slade Stinson and Ted Shannon officiating. Burial will follow in the Tackett Cemetery, at McDowell.

Visitation will take place after 6 p.m., Thursday, at the funeral home.

Nelson Frazier Funeral Home, of Martin, is in charge of arrangements.
